The Crisis Before the Cure: Why Jobiffy Had to Exist
Before you look at Jobiffy, you must look at the disaster it
is fixing.
India doesn’t have a "talent" problem. Do we have
a "degree" problem? No. We have a "Conversion" problem.
Even at the top, the walls are crumbling:
● 21,500 IITians fought for a future.
● 8,000 walked away with nothing.
● That’s 1 in 3 IIT graduates left in the dark.
Between 2020 and 2026, nearly 30,000 students from India’s
elite campuses couldn't find a seat at the table. Move to Tier-2 IIMs and
B-schools, and the story gets worse 46% of graduates are struggling to survive.
They have the degrees. They have the effort. They have the
ambition.
The system is not failing because students lack talent. The
system is failing because it doesn't know how to turn that talent into a job.
This is where the Jobiffy story begins. Not as a company, but as a fix for a
broken nation.
